Nestled in the breathtaking Ku-ring-gai Chase National Park, The Basin Wharf is a picturesque ferry terminal offering stunning views and access to outdoor adventures. Ideal for a day trip, it combines natural beauty with recreational activities, making it a must-visit for tourists looking to explore New South Wales' coastal splendor.

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ring The Basin Wharf.
- Check the ferry schedule in advance to plan your trip effectively, especially during weekends.
- Bring along a picnic to enjoy at the scenic spots around the wharf.
- Wear comfortable footwear for exploring the walking trails and sandy beaches.
- Consider visiting during the early morning or late afternoon for stunning light and fewer crowds.

Getting There
-
Car
If you're traveling by car, head towards Ku-ring-gai Chase National Park. The Basin Wharf is located at the end of The Basin Road. From Sydney Basin, take the A1 Pacific Motorway north, then exit onto the B68 to follow signs for Ku-ring-gai Chase. Drive along West Head Road, which will lead you to The Basin Road. Follow The Basin Road until you reach the car park near the wharf. Note that there may be parking fees, so be prepared with cash or a card.
-
Public Transport
To reach The Basin Wharf using public transport, take a bus from Sydney Basin to Palm Beach. You can catch the L90 or L88 bus from the central bus station. The journey will take approximately 1 hour. Once you arrive at Palm Beach, transfer to the ferry service that operates from Palm Beach Wharf to The Basin Wharf. The ferry ride usually takes around 20 minutes. Be sure to check the ferry schedule ahead of time for the latest departure times and any fare costs.
-
Ferry
If you're already at Palm Beach Wharf, you can take the ferry directly to The Basin Wharf. The ferry service is typically operated by Sydney Ferries, and tickets can be purchased at the wharf. The cost for a standard adult ticket is approximately AUD 10. Make sure to arrive at least 10 minutes before the scheduled departure to secure your spot.
